Local notes for North Carolina
A few state-specific considerations to keep in mind while you compare quotes and providers:
- If backups repeat, discuss prevention steps and maintenance schedules.
- Root intrusion and heavy rain are common triggers—camera inspection can clarify the cause.
- Ask how they handle containment and sanitation in basements or crawlspaces.
